Study Summary

The goal of this observational study is to validate changes in speech as a measure of cognition in individuals at increased risk of Alzheimer's disease and related dementias (ADRD). This study aims to clarify how speech may be affected by Alzheimer's disease. Participants will complete speech collection sessions and a survey at home using an iPad. Participants can expect to be in the study for 3 years.
